What matters for Starbound (4K)

Starbound is a 2D sandbox adventure that mixes exploration, crafting, base building, and survival across a procedurally generated universe of planets, space stations, and story quests. Players repair their ship, land on randomly created worlds, gather resources, fight monsters, and construct elaborate bases, either solo or in online co-op. Most fans treat it as a long-term hobby: hundreds of hours spent expanding outposts, installing mods for new races or biomes, and hosting multiplayer servers. On PC, the game feels responsive during normal travel but can become frustrating when the simulation load spikes. At 4K the experience changes because the fixed-size pixel assets are drawn across a much larger screen area. This means the engine simultaneously processes and renders far more tiles, background layers, parallax effects, and active creatures than at lower resolutions. Although the visuals remain 2D, the CPU must keep up with increased world simulation and entity updates across that wider viewport. The primary performance load therefore comes from the CPU rather than the graphics card. Common pain points include micro-stutters when entering dense forests or player-built bases, longer asset loading with large mod packs, and occasional frame drops during multiplayer when the host simulates additional entities. Many new builders mistakenly focus on a high-end GPU expecting the game to behave like a modern 3D title. In reality Starbound makes modest demands on the graphics processor while remaining sensitive to CPU architecture, RAM speed and capacity, and fast storage for mod files. Before choosing hardware for 4K Starbound, understand that smooth long play sessions and mod compatibility matter more than raw frame-rate numbers. The sensible PC for this scenario delivers strong multi-core performance to prevent simulation bottlenecks and enough memory to keep large worlds and mod assets in RAM.

Why this build makes sense

This build is designed to give reliable performance at 4K by concentrating budget on the components that actually limit Starbound: CPU simulation power, memory capacity for mods, and fast storage for quick planet loading. It accepts a mid-range graphics card because the game’s DirectX 9 pixel-art engine does not scale with high-end GPU horsepower, freeing money for parts that reduce the stutters and lag players actually notice during extended sessions. The AMD Ryzen 7 9700X provides eight strong cores and excellent single-thread speed, directly addressing the CPU-bound nature of procedural generation and entity handling at 4K. Paired with 32GB of DDR5-6000 RAM, the system can keep larger modded worlds resident in memory instead of constantly paging to storage, reducing hitches when exploring complex biomes or entering crowded bases. The RTX 5070 12GB supplies more than enough rendering performance while adding modern features and driver stability that indirectly help with any future engine updates or heavy visual mods, yet the card is not oversized for Starbound’s low VRAM and GPU demands. Supporting components complete a balanced system: the ASUS Prime B650-PLUS WiFi board offers solid VRMs and future upgrade headroom on the AM5 platform, the WD_BLACK SN850X 2TB NVMe SSD cuts loading times for big mod collections, and the Thermalright Peerless Assassin air cooler keeps the efficient 65W Ryzen running quietly under sustained loads. A 650W power supply provides safe overhead without excess cost. By avoiding an ultra-high-end GPU and instead investing in CPU, RAM, and storage, this configuration matches Starbound’s real hardware requirements at 4K while delivering stable exploration, base building, and multiplayer performance for both vanilla and heavily modded play.
